HandDrawn Film is seeking a talented and resourceful Visual FX Artist/Producer to join the post-production team on our latest feature film, The Invisibles. The film is currently approaching the end of the edit and weeks away from grade and online.
What we need:
- A VFX artist who can work remotely across late July into August, with skills in:
- Creating travelling mattes
- Keying and clean-up
- Polishing and enhancing FX already created during the shoot and edit
About the project:
The Invisibles is a completed, zero-budget feature with strong creative momentum. While the fee is nominal, this is a fantastic credit on a fully shot feature film, and a great opportunity to be part of an ambitious indie production with a clear finish line.
